Kikuyu, also called Gikuyu or Agikuyu, Bantu-speaking people who live in the highland area of south-central Kenya, near Mount Kenya. In the late 20th century the Kikuyu numbered more than 4,400,000 and formed the largest ethnic group in Kenya, approximately 20 percent of the total population.

Many tribes in Kenya give high value to coming of age rituals which are mostly signified by circumcision. In the olden days, tribes such as the Kikuyu, Meru, Masai and Samburu circumcised both boys and girls. Most of them have abandoned girl circumcision owing to the many health and social problems it ...

Web1 day ago · According to Kikuyu culture, Mt Kenya is the abode of Mwenenyaga, their deity. Kikuyu traditionalists pray facing the mountain. "It is an affront to Gikuyu spirituality, for members of this community to desecrate our Supreme Altar by raising their flag on Kīrīnyaga (Mt Kenya)," said Kimani Charagu, a founding member of Booi wa Kirira.
